WebA burst fracture is a type of traumatic spinal injury in which a vertebra breaks from a high-energy axial load (e.g., traffic collisions or falls from a great height or high speed, and some kinds of seizures), with shards of vertebra penetrating surrounding tissues and sometimes the spinal canal. WebThe difference between (time) of the turn around and burst time is known as the waiting time of a process. BT (Burst Time) – It is the total time that a process requires for its overall execution. Thus, TAT – BT = WT . Now, we can also easily calculate the Turn Around Time using the Burst Time and the Waiting Time. Here, BT + WT = TAT
